Interesting pieces, and we wrote a post to break it down for you.<br> <br> Two more top LDS leaders leave the Republican Party and switch to "unaffiliated." Between the First Presidency at the Quorum of the Twelve, nine are registered Republicans and six are now unaffiliated. Is "unaffiliated" code speak for "Libertarian"? Are the unaffiliated ones more moderate or too conservative for the GOP?
